Head of Marine Services and Transportation
35 hours per week, Permanent
Salary: £100,250 (Including Distant Islands Allowance)
Are you an experienced and visionary leader with a passion for delivering high quality services? Do you want to make a real difference in one of the most beautiful and community-focused parts of the UK?
Orkney Islands Council is seeking an exceptional individual to join our Extended Corporate Leadership Team as Head of Marine Services and Transportation. This is a strategic leadership role with responsibility for a diverse and dynamic portfolio including:
- Marine Services (the Harbour Authority, Pilotage, Towage Services, Pier Operations, Launch operations, Vessel Traffic Services and Local Lighthouse Authority).
- Internal Ferry Service operations and management of the ferry fleet.
- Marine business development, commercial success, the self-financing of all harbour activities and delivery of the Port Master Plan.
- Harbours and Marine Engineering Services.
- Marine and Airfield asset management (including ships, piers and airfields).
- Airfield and internal air service operations including membership of the Air Safety Review Board.
- Strategic Transportation (policy, bus and air contracts).
- The delivery of those public transport services which are a Council responsibility including lifeline services (air, bus and ferry).

View full company profileForget images of remote islands - Orkney is well served by superb modern transport links. Forget the idea of a few people in the middle of no-where - Orkney is home to over 20,000 people. Orkney may bring to mind certain images, but the chances are they are, to say the least, a little off the mark. Sure, we're a bit off the beaten track, but the needs of our community are just the same as anywhere else. And, as a result, the opportunities we can offer you are comparable with those you'll find elsewhere. Of course, there are a few differences: for starters Orkney consists of 100,000 hectares spread over 70+ small islands (19 of which are inhabited), so, like our service users, you'll need to make the most of the transportation links which are vital to Orkney's social and economic well-being. Orkney Islands Council may be the smallest local authority in Scotland, but we can offer some big challenges. And big opportunities. This could be your big chance to make the move, and make a difference. OIC has an impact on many aspects of everyday life. With around 1,800 staff, we are also the county’s biggest employer.
